World Cup generated $20B in blockchain prediction market volume: Chainalysis

User Image

Por Anônimo

Criado July 31, 2026|1 min de leitura
Main Image

The blockchain analytics firm said the World Cup attracted global participation in prediction markets and digital collectibles, with more than 400,000 wallets placing blockchain-based bets.
